i have a roll pan, and most other dak owners have one too. i was always troubled by their areodynamics. the back of all the roll pans ive seen are coupled, so wouldnt this be a big drag on our trucks? imagine going 30+ and holding your roll pan against the wind... it would drag on it alot. ive been thinkin about making some sort of deflector that could route the air smoothly down and under the roll pan, not into it. going 115+, i would think a bolted on pan might flap around alot, causing stress on the screws and maybe the paint... i might get a steel pan and have it welded in with a deflector.
